Red Bay saw some tournament action on Friday. They came up short against the Humboldt Vikings, falling 86-66. Despite running the score up even higher than they did in their prior game last Tuesday (63), the Tigers still had to take the loss.

Despite the defeat, Red Bay saw an underclassman step up: freshman Khalil Luster dropped a double-double on 29 points and 18 boards. As a matter of fact, that's the most points Luster has scored all season.
Red Bay's loss dropped their record down to 10-5. As for Humboldt, they have been performing well recently as they've won three of their last four matchups, which provided a nice bump to their 8-3 record this season.
Coincidentally, the two teams will both be playing Obion County the next time they take the court. Red Bay will head out to face Obion County at 1:30 p.m. on Saturday, while Humboldt will head out to face them at 10:00 a.m. on Friday.
